How can I get medical certificate?

Medical Certificate Contents

  1. Name and address of the patient.
  2. Name and address of the doctor/ medical practitioner.
  3. The exact period of leave/time off that is medically justifiable.
  4. Nature/ degree of incapacitation/ injury/ illness.
  5. Date of medical diagnosis and the date of issue of the certificate.

Who can give medical certificate?

Yes, a medical practitioner can issue a medical certificate after a patient has taken sick leave, providing the certificate states:

  • the date the certificate was issued.
  • the period during which the practitioner believes the patient would have been unfit for work.

How long is a medical certificate valid?

The competent authority will have established national requirements for the medical examination and certificate. FS/PS Guidelines – Medical certificates are valid for a maximum period of two years for persons older than 18 years. For persons younger than 18 years the validity shall not exceed one year.
